Transaction 84fe67e9a4970f0bb7cd002f84d287636523222ea753a140cbb97be0c2a1c3ac
1 Input
1 Output
-
84fe67e9a4970f0bb7cd002f84d287636523222ea753a140cbb97be0c2a1c3ac:0
- value
- 10374386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fe0fe6696336a529f45a81c25cfe888e32bc529 OP_EQUAL
- address
- 37Wn2UAErSWP5TeJkNJMDGNVBJGWB7pDkU